Output ec0e2bad16d4c66e7ec48722f68da838bc2fcfc6700bcf5e7a384bf7e51a8cd7:14

value
40473511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a87d4d7e14cf11a6c82aae6e9fb18451ce265bd OP_EQUAL
address
3HEhWtRPUpYcmcSeCLWV6FJUj2mzRFA2sA
transaction
ec0e2bad16d4c66e7ec48722f68da838bc2fcfc6700bcf5e7a384bf7e51a8cd7
spent
true